022254 Patel M B;Mishra S H (Pharmacy Dep, Herbal Drug Technology Laboratory, Faculty of Technology, The Maharaja Sayajrao University of Baroda, Vadodara, Gujarat, India-390 001) : Simple spectrofluorometric estimation of wedelolactone in methanol extract of Eclipta alba. J Pharmac Mag 2006, 2(7), 160-4.
A simple, accurate and sensitive spectrofluorophotometric method was developed for estimation of wedelolactone, a furanocoumarin present as a major active constituent in the methanol extract of the plant Eclipta alba. Wedelolactone showed strong bright blue fluorescence having excitation and emission wavelength 384 and 458 nm. respectively. Linear relationship for the fluorescence intensity was obtained in the range 5-30 ng/mL. Limit of detection and limit of quantification was found to be 0.5 mg/mL and 2 mg/mL, respectively. The method was statistically validated and found suitable for estimation of wedelolactone in a methanol extract of plant Edipta alba.

022251 Naik U G;Naik R K;Nayak V N (Fisherman Guidance Bureau, Karnatak University PG Center, Karwar-581 303) : Primary productivity in the Karwar bay, Karnataka, west coast of India. Envir Ecol 2006, 24(4), 827-31.
Measurement of primary production is of great importance because of its significance to the problems of aquatic ecology and fishery management. The interaction of light intensity, temperature and nutrient levels determines the photosynthetic efficiency of an aquatic ecosystem. Studies on primary productivity was carried out in Karwar bay at three study sites during September 1999 to August 2000. Study area was quite turbid and the euphotic zone never exceeded 2.2 m. The column production ranged from 3.81 to 257.7 mg C/m2 per day (with an average of 55.56 mg C/m2 per day). Rate of production at all study stations was maximum during August/September. Ch1. a maxima was registered during July/August. Correlation between nutrients (nitrate and phosphate) and production was low indicating an instantaneous concentration of these nutrients salts. An estimated annual primary production potential of the present study area (15.54 km2) was 315 t C.

022244 Mastan S A;Goswami S;Kakaria V K;Qureshi T A (Applied Aquaculture Dep, Barkatullah Univ, Bhopal-462 026, Email: shaikmastan2000@yahoo.com) : Development of primary cell culture from heart explants of common carp, Cyprinus carpio (Linn). J Cell Tissue Res 2007, 7(2), 1053-6.
Primary cell cultures of heart cells were initiated from heart tissue explants of common carp, Cyprinus carpio. The hearts were collected aseptically from 8-10 g (2-3 inch) fingerling after killing them by a blow on head. Before seeding, the tissues were minced in phosphate buffer saline (PBS) with antibiotic/antimycolic mixture. The explants were cultured in minimum essential medium (MEM) with 10% foetal bovine serum (FBS) and antibiotic/antimycotic mixture. Approximately 50% of minced heart tissue was subjected to standard trypsinisation method with 0.25% trypsin - EDTA solution. The cell pellets were suspended in MEM with 10 % FBS. They were incubated at room temperature. After 40-48 h of attachment, several types of cells were found to grow. A good and confluent monolayer found in three weeks time. In present experiment, the explant method was found to be better than trypsinisation for initiation of primary culture. The attachment efficiency and growth of cells were better and fast in explant method than trypsinisation.

022241 Leal P F;Queiroga C L;Rodrigues M V N;J I Montanari;Angela M;Meireles A (College of Food Engineering), UNICAMP (State University of Campinas), Caixa Postal 6121, 13083-862, Campinas, SP, Brazil) : Global yields, chemical compositions, and antioxidant activitiy of extracts from Achyrocline alata and Achyrocline satureioides. J Pharmac Mag 2006, 2(7), 150-6.
Extracts from leaves and thin branches of Achyrocline alata and Achyrocline satureioides were obtained by supercritical fluid extraction, hydrodistillation, and low-pressure ethanol extraction. The supercritical extractions were done at pressures of 100, 200, and 300 bar and temperatures of 30 and 40°. The chemical constituents of the extracts and volatile oil were identified by GC-MS and quantified by GC-FID. The antioxidant activity was determined using the coupled oxidation of linolenic acid and β-carotene. Larger yields were detected at 200 bar and 30°C. Low-pressure ethanol extraction yield was 2.96% (m/m, dry basis) for A. satureioides and 3.98% (m/m, dry basis.) for A. alata. The major compounds of the extracts were trans-caryophyllene and α-humulene; the content of trans-caryophyllene in the A. alata extract obtained at 200 bar and 30° C was 5 times larger than that of the A. satureioides extracts. All extracts exhibited antioxidant activity stronger than β-carotene.

022238 Kumar O;Kulkarni A S;Nashikkar A B; Vijayaraghavan R (Pharmacology and Toxicology Div, Defence Research and Development Establishment, Gwalior-474002, Email: omkumar63@rediffmail com) : Protective effect of quercetin on sulphur mustard induced oxidative stress in mice. J Cell Tissue Res 2007, 7(2), 1173-9.
Sulphur mustard (SM, 2, 2' dichloro diethyl sulphide) is a potent chemical warfare agent for which there is still no effective antidote. SM is known to cause oxidative stress. The protective effect of quercetin, a bioflavonoid following SM toxicity. 2.0 and 4.0 LD50 of SM (1 LD50=9.67 mg/kg; 14 days observation for mortality) was administered to Swiss albino female mice through percutaneous route. SM exposed mice were treated with quercetin (100 and 200 mg/kg) three times by intraperitoneal injection, one immediately following SM exposure, then once each day for 2 days after SM treatment. The effect of quercetin on survival, body weight, markers of oxidative damage (in blood, liver and kidney), WBC counts and purine metabolite were investigated 7 day post exposure. Survival time increased significantly following quercetin treatment. The decrease in body weight due to SM was prevented to a significant extent by quercetin. Significant decrease in reduced glutathione and increase in the level of malondialdehyde indicated oxidative damage to hepatic and renal tissues. Quercetin protected hepatic and renal tissues from oxidative damage caused by SM. Alterations in WBC counts and end product of purine metabolite were also prevented by quercetin. This study shows that quercetin enhanced the survival time, restored the decrease in body weight and protected hepatic and renal tissues from oxidative damage.

022235 Karadi R V;Kavatagimath S A;Gaviraj E N; Sastry D N;Chandrashekhara S;Rajarajeshwari N (Pharmaceutical Biotechnology Dep, KLES College of Pharmacy, Belgaum-590 010, Email: rvkaradi@yahoo com) : Evaluation of Plumbago indica callus for its plumbagin content and antimicrobial activity. J Cell Tissue Res 2007, 7(2), 1131-6.
Plumbagin is commercially important because of its broad range of pharmacological activities such as antimicrobial, anticancer, antifertile and insecticidal. Production of this metabolite by plant cell culture is required as the native Plumbago species produce only small amount of this compound after 2-6 years of growth. In order to study the biosynthetic potential of in vitro cultures, efforts were made to establish callus cultures from leaves and shoot tips of Plumbago indica on Murashige and Skoog (MS) and Gamborg's (B5) media containing varying amounts of auxins and cytokinins. Callus initiation was seen in both media but a greater frequency was obtained in MS. Growth was highest in MS media supplemented with 2,4-dichlorophenoxy acetic acid (2 mg/l) and Kinetin (0.5 mg/l) but maximal production of plumbagin was seen in the presence of 1-naphthalein acetic acid (2 mg/l) and kinetin (0.5 mg/l). Calli exhibited an initial lag phase before entering an active growth phase around day 12 and reached stationary phase 24 days after inoculation. The synthesis of plumbagin was found to be non-growth-associated with minimum in early exponential phase (0.31 mg/g dry weight on day 12) and maximum in early stationary phase (2.45 mg/g dry weight on day 24) of culture. Calli were elicited with copper sulphate and silver nitrate but the amount of plumbagin was enhanced by about 2-fold to 7.61 mg/g dry weight by the former at 10 μM. Antimicrobial studies showed a close correlation of activity with the production of plumbagin indicating in vitro cultures are capable of producing bioactive secondary substances.

022215 Bachhawat A K (NO, , ) : Comparative genomics - a powerful new tool in biology. Resonance 2007, 11(8), 22-40.
An important hallmark of biological research is the aspect of 'comparisons'. As the complete genome sequences of numerous organisms have become available, the emphasis in biology has shifted to comparisons at the genome level. The last few years have witnessed an exponential rise in the number of organisms whose complete genome has been sequenced, and we are still climbing up the graph. Explains how one can extract a great deal of information from such analyses that is of great value in our research. The subject of comparative genomics impinges on evolutionary biology and phylogenetic reconstructions of the tree of life, drug discovery programs, function predictions of hypothetical proteins and genes, regulatory motifs and other non-coding DNA motifs, and genome flux and dynamics. Finally describes how the information one can extract from a comparative analysis of genomes depends to a large extent, on the specific aspect of the genomes that is being compared and the phylogenetic distances of the organisms involved.

022214 Anbarasu A;Ramalingam K (Zoology P. G. and Research Dep, Government Arts College (Men) (Autonomous), Nandanam, Chennai-35, Email: drkrimmunotoxicol@yahoo.co.in) : Studies on the sublethal dosage of mercuric chloride (Hgcl2) on tissue GOT and GPT of Scylla tranquebarica (fabricius). Aquacult 2007, 8(1), 33-44.
Sublethal dosages of mercuric chloride on the tissue transaminase activity in mud crab Scylla tranquebarica revealed that there was an enhancement of GPT activity following exposure to mercuric chloride. GPT enhancement was very much marked in the case of hepatopancreas at all the intervals in all the concentrations. Similarly in muscles also, the GPT increased after 7 and 30 days. The GPT activity in hemolymph in contrast to the other two tissues showed no marked changes. GOT showed an enhancement in the hepatopancreas at all the intervals when compared to initial zero hour. In muscle, GOT showed an enhancement after 7 days and 15 days in 0.001 ppm. In 0.0001 ppm concentration it showed the enhancement only after 15 days. In 0.01 ppm it showed enhancement after 7 days and 30 days. The GOT activity in the hemolymph was enhanced at all the intervals, in 0.001 and 0.0001 ppm concentration, whereas in 0.01 ppm a consistent decrease was noticed. The enhancement of GOT and GPT in the tissues and consequent formation of glutamate may be required in stressed conditions for the conversion of toxic ammonia to its non-toxic storage form viz., glutamine. Transaminase activities suggest that nitrogen metabolism in the mercury exposed crabs turned towards the better utilization of nitrogen source.

022212 Aburjai T;Hudaib M (Pharmaceutical Sciences Dep, Faculty of Pharmacy, Jordan Univ, Amman, Jordan, Email: aburjai@ju.edu.jo) : Antiplatelet, antibacterial and antifungal activities of Achillea falcata extracts and evaluation of volatile oil composition. J Pharmac Mag 2006, 2(7), 188-95.
The antiplatelet, antibacterial and antifungal effects of various extracts obtained from Jordanian Achillea falcata L. were studied. Chemical composition of the volatile oil hydrodistilled from the plant aerial parts was also evaluated by GC and GC/MS. Among the 41 constituents identified in the oil, camphor (17.0%), 1,8-cineole (15.9%), p-cymene (11.3%) and β-thujone (9.8%) were the major components. The volatile oil exhibited potent antibacterial activity against standard and resistant strains of both gram positive and gram negative bacteria. The oil showed also significant inhibition against Candida albicans and Trichosporon cutaneum. Alcoholic extract revealed good activity against Escherichia coli, resistant strain of Pseudomonas aeurogenosa and C. albicans. It also showed significant inhibitory effect against platelet aggregation induced by collagen and ADP (IC50: 48.1, 112.1 μg/ml respectively). The aqueous extract revealed moderate activity against fungal species, in particular C. albicans, while it showed no inhibition against blood aggregation induced either by collagen or ADP.

021363 Vashishtha A;Upadhyay R (Botany Dep, Delhi Univ, Delhi-110 007, Email: rkupad@yahoo.com) : Polyploidy:genetic improvement of plants and animals. J appl Biosci 2006, 32(2), 126-34.
In nature, both plants and animals have shown long evolutionary association and have inherited similarities and dissimilarities both at structural and chromosomal level. Numerical differences in chromosomes have played more important role in evolution of genetic variabilities, environmental adaptations and ecological stability. Genetic variabilities that occurred in both groups were produced by the process of recombination, transversion and translocation. In plants, polyploidy controls cell size, fruit morphology and fruit ripening, tuber formation, seed germination and helps in restoration of fertility. Polyploidy is also helpful in production of disease resistant and stress tolerant new cultivars of high economic value. In animals, polyploidy enhance milk production, hormone secretion, stock culture improvement and also helps in disease alleviation. In the field of agriculture, there are enormous possibilities to develop desirable traits in cereal crops for improvement of grain yield and fruit production. In future, these genetically improved or modified animals and plants may become helpful in the eradication of poverty and in the field of medical sciences polyploid cells and heterokaryons of diverse nature may help in the treatment of diseases.
